INSTALLATION

2.1

UNPACKING PROCEDURE

1. Remove the Controller from its packing. The Controller is supplied
with a panel gasket and push-fit fixing strap. Retain the packing for
future use, should it be necessary to transport the Controller to a
different site or to return it to the supplier for repair/testing.
2. Examine the delivered items for damage or deficiencies. If any is
found, notify the carrier immediately.
2.2
PANEL-MOUNTING THE
CONTROLLER
The panel on which the Controller is to be
mounted must be rigid and may be up to 6.0mm
(0.25 inches) thick. The cut-out required for a
single Controller is as shown in Figure 2-1.
Several controllers may be installed in a single
cut-out, side-by-side. For n Controllers mounted
side-by-side, the width of the cut-out would be:
(48n - 4) millimetres or (3.78n - 0.16) inches.
The Controller Programmer is 110mm deep (measured from the rear face of the front
panel). The front panel is 48mm high and 48mm wide. When panel-mounted, the
front panel projects 10mm from the mounting panel. The main dimensions of the
Controller are shown in Figure 2-2.
